- Prep: 1 hr 10 min
- Cook Time: –
- Serving: Makes about 2-1/2 cups
Using plain Greek-style yogurt makes this dip a creamier and healthier alternative to a traditional mayonnaise and sour cream blend.
Ingredients
- 1 medium cucumber, peeled and finely chopped
- 2 cups Greek-style yogurt
- 1 teaspoon cumin seeds (roasted and coarsely ground, for garnish)
- 2 tablespoons fresh coriander, chopped
- 1/4 teaspoon red chili powder
- Sea salt to taste
Directions
- Place the cumin seeds in a small skillet and toast for a few seconds over medium heat until fragrant.
- Place the yogurt in a bowl along with 1/2 the cumin, salt, chili powder, cucumber and coriander. Mix until thoroughly blended.
- Garnish the dip with the remaining cumin, cover and chill for 1 hour before serving.
